Agile-трансформация

Заказать уникальный реферат
Тип работы: Реферат
Предмет: Управление
  • 25 25 страниц
  • 7 + 7 источников
  • Добавлена 23.12.2023
748 руб.
  • Содержание
  • Часть работы
  • Список литературы
Введение 3
1. Основные принципы и ценности Agile-методологий 5
1.1 Изучение и объяснение основных принципов Agile-методологий 5
1.2 Определение основных ценностей Agile-методологий 6
2 Процесс Agile-трансформации 9
2.1 Описание и изучение этапов процесса Agile-трансформации 9
2.2 Использование процесса Agile-трансформации на конкретных примерах 11
3 Преимущества и вызовы при внедрении Agile-трансформации 14
3.1 Основные преимущества Agile-трансформации 14
3.2 Вызовы Agile-трансформации для лидеров бизнеса 16
4 Инструменты и практики, используемые в Agile-трансформации 21
4.2 Примеры использования инструментов Agile-трансформации 22
Заключение 24
Список использованных источников и литературы 26
Фрагмент для ознакомления

Управление переходит от модели, которая распределяет работу между людьми и затем управляет прогрессом, к роли, которая фокусируется на росте людей, обеспечении честной обратной связи и обучении их.Важные вопросы, такие как сроки, отслеживание затрат или контроль прогресса абсолютно справедливы и необходимы. Разница в том, что мы переходим из парадигмы, в которой были уверены, что можем предсказать результаты заранее, фиксируя их в планах, к новой парадигме, в которой мы можем только прогнозировать и, по мере прогресса, постоянно обновлять прогноз.4. Выбор модели масштабирования Agile• ScrumofScrums - не самостоятельный framework, а скорее подход, в котором большая команда Scrum делится на несколько маленьких. Условно подходит для команд численностью 12-30 FTE, но допускает значительно больше.• Nexus - надстройка над Scrum, которая позволяет скоординировать работу нескольких команд над одним инкрементом. Как и Scrum, состоит из таких элементов, как роли, церемонии и артефакты. Условно подходит для команд численностью 30-60 FTE.• LeSS - масштабный Scrum. Хорошо подходит для управления большим числом команд. Есть так же производная - LeSSHuge, в которой появляются дополнительные артефакты и роли - Areaproductowner c командой помощников. Условно подходит для команд численностью до 1000 FTE.• SAFe – масштабирование именно Agile. Включает в себя Scrum, но не ограничивается им, используя так же Kanban, Lean, eXtremeProgramming и пр. Предусматривает 4 уровня скейла и свой набор bestpractices для каждого их них. Требует гораздо более комплексного подхода, чем прочие практики. На уровне портфолио компании ограничений численности нет.• Thespotify-model – локализованный в SpotifyAgile со специфичным набором команд, имеющих полную свободу выбора в применении методологий и фреймворков гибкой разработки на уровне конкретного Tribe (или команды). За пределами Spotify известно применение только в одной компании, и появилась еще одна попытка внедрения в РФ. Подходит для команд FTE 30+.• DisciplinedAgileDelivery (DAD) – набор инструментов для принятия процессных решений. Состоит из 4-х уровней. Помогает выбирать процессы в зависимости от ситуации. DAD описывает, как разные подходы работают в совокупности и в каком случае они нужны. Позиционируется как инструментарий, который помогает выбрать правильный подход, методологию или framework из существующего набора.4 Инструменты и практики, используемые в Agile-трансформации4.1 Основные инструменты и практики, используемые в Agile-трансформацииВ процессе Agile -трансформации применяются различные инструменты и практики для поддержки команд и организации в достижении Agile -результатов. Ниже приведены некоторые из них:1. Scrum: Скрам- это инкрементальная, итеративная методология разработки программного обеспечения, основанная на принципах транспарентности, проверки и адаптации. Scrum определяетроли (Product Owner, Scrum Master, Development Team), артефакты (Product Backlog, Sprint Backlog, Increment) исобытия (Sprint Planning, Daily Scrum, Sprint Review, Sprint Retrospective).2. Kanban: Канбан- это метод управления задачами с использованием визуальных досок. Задачи представлены в виде карточек, которые перемещаются между колонками на доске для отслеживания статуса и прогресса. Канбан способствует более гибкому планированию и управлению рабочим потоком.3. TeamChartering: Это процесс формирования команды, который включает определение ролей, целей, правил сотрудничества. Команда четко определяет свою миссию и устанавливает соглашения о взаимодействии, что способствует эффективной работы.4. Retrospective: Ретроспектива - это периодическое мероприятие, во время которого команда анализирует свою работу, выделяет улучшения и изменения для следующих итераций. Ретроспектива помогает командам принять осознанные решения и продолжать улучшать свою эффективность.5. ContinuousIntegration/ContinuousDelivery (CI/CD): CI/CD - это практика автоматической сборки, тестирования и развертывания приложений, которая позволяет обеспечивать постоянную готовность к развертыванию и доставке высококачественного программного обеспечения.6. AgileMindset: Это основная философия Agile, которая заключается в предоставлении преимущества взаимодействию и сотрудничеству перед процессами и инструментами. AgileMindset способствует постоянному обучению, обратной связи и изменениям в обстановке.7. AgileCoaching: Agile-тренеры и коучи предоставляют поддержку и руководство для команд и организации в процессе Agile -трансформации. Они помогают развить Agile -умения и навыки, а также поощряют процесс улучшения и инноваций.8. LeanThinking: Принципы LeanThinking (такие как минимизация потерь, непрерывное улучшение, повышение качества и ценности для клиента) часто применяются в Agile -трансформации для оптимизации рабочих процессов и доставки бизнес-ценности.Эти инструменты и практики являются лишь некоторыми из множества доступных в Agile -трансформации. Выбор конкретных инструментов и практик зависит от контекста и потребностей организации.4.2 Примеры использования инструментов Agile-трансформацииДля большего понимания основных инструментов Agile-трансформации рассмотрим некоторые примеры, в которых они применяются:1. Внедрение методологии Scrum в отделе разработки программного обеспечения: команда разработчиков выстраивает свою работу в виде итераций (спринтов), каждый из которых продолжается от 1 до 4 недель. В конце каждого спринта команда предоставляет готовый продукт, который может быть проверен и протестирован2. Проведение dailystand-up-митингов: команда проводит короткое ежедневное собрание (не более 15 минут), на котором обсуждаются задачи, выполненные работы, проблемы и планы на ближайший день. Это помогает команде быть в курсе всех текущих активностей и решить возникающие проблемы в кратчайшие сроки.3. Использование backlog-а: команда поддерживает список задач, которые нужно выполнить (backlog) и постоянно обновляет его, добавляя новые задачи, изменяя приоритеты или удаляя задачи, которые больше не требуются. Вся команда имеет доступ к этому списку, и каждый участник может взять на себя выполнение любой задачи из backlog-а.4. Регулярное применение ретроспективных собраний: после каждого спринта команда оценивает свою работу, обсуждает, что работало хорошо, что можно улучшить и что следует изменить в следующем спринте. Это помогает команде учиться на своих ошибках и постоянно совершенствовать свой процесс работы.5. Внедрение continuousintegration и continuousdelivery: команда разработчиков использует автоматизированные инструменты для интеграции и тестирования кода на регулярной основе, а также для автоматической доставки готового продукта на тестовый или производственный сервер. Это позволяет команде быстро получать обратную связь и реагировать на обнаруженные проблемы.6. Создание кросс-функциональных команд: вместо того, чтобы разделить задачи по функциональным областям (например, дизайнеры, разработчики, тестировщики), команда формируется на основе навыков и опыта, необходимых для выполнения конкретной задачи. Это позволяет ускорить процесс разработки и улучшить качество продукта.ЗаключениеВ заключение, можно сказать, что Agile-трансформация является необходимым шагом для компаний, стремящихся к инновациям и успешному развитию в современных условиях. Процесс внедрения Agile-подхода позволяет улучшить коммуникацию, повысить гибкость и отзывчивость к изменениям, создать более эффективную и продуктивную рабочую среду. В результате, компания становится способной быстрее адаптироваться к меняющимся требованиям рынка, достигать поставленных целей и удовлетворять потребности клиентов. Однако, стоит отметить, что Agile-трансформация не является процессом, имеющим четкую инициацию и завершение - это постоянная работа над собой, постоянное совершенствование и развитие. Поэтому, компании должны быть готовы к непрерывным изменениям и учиться адаптироваться к ним, чтобы оставаться конкурентоспособными и успешными в долгосрочной перспективе.В ходе написания работы были проанализированы основные принципы и ценности Agile-трансформации, подробно описаны этапы процессов, приведены различные примеры использования Agile-трансформации, а также выделены преимущества при внедрении Agile-трансформации.Agile-трансформация является необходимым и неотъемлемым процессом в современном бизнесе. Благодаря внедрению принципов и практик агильного подхода, компании получают возможность гибко и оперативно адаптироваться к изменениям на рынке, повышать эффективность работы команды и достигать более высоких результатов.Этот процесс может быть вызывающим и требующим определенных усилий и времени для привыкания и осознания новых подходов к работе. Однако, в конечном итоге он приносит значительные преимущества и улучшает конкурентоспособность компании.Agile-трансформация требует поддержки руководства и активного участия всех участников команды. Важно создать атмосферу доверия, где каждый член команды может предложить свои идеи и внести свой вклад в успех проекта.Все изменения внедряются постепенно и систематически, начиная с небольших пилотных проектов. Это позволяет выявить проблемы и недостатки, а также внести необходимые корректировки для улучшения процесса.Важно отметить, что Agile-трансформация - это не конечная точка, а непрерывный процесс. Компании должны постоянно стремиться к совершенствованию и внедрять новые инновации и методологии, чтобы оставаться впереди конкурентов.В итоге, Agile-трансформация способствует развитию компании, созданию эффективных и высокопроизводительных команд, а также обеспечивает конкурентное преимущество на рынке. Все это делает ее одним из ключевых факторов успеха в современном бизнесе.Список использованных источников и литературыЛобасев Д. В. Фреймворк Agile-трансформации крупных организаций // Актуальные исследования. –2022. – С. 26-33. URL: https://apni.ru/article/5011-frejmvork-agile-transformatsii-krupnikh-organМашков А. Что такое Agile // Week.ru – [Москва], 2022. – URL: https://weeek.net/ru/blog/chto-takoe-agile«Газпром нефть» рассказала о внедрении Agile на самой крупной конференции по гибким методологиям // Специализированный журнал «Бурение&Нефть» – 2018. –URL:https://burneft.ru/main/news/207625-летие Sbergile: итоги самой большой Agile-трансформации в мире // ПАО Сбербанк– [Москва], 2021. – URL:https://www.sberbank.com/ru/news-and-media/press-releases/article?newsID=27df3305-bbb2-41d1-ab6d-34e85d12abd7&blockID=7®ionID=77&lang=ru&type=NEWS,%202021.4 вызова Agile трансформации для лидеров бизнеса // vc.ru - Крупнейшая в России и СНГ площадка для предпринимателей нового поколения – 2020. –URL:https://vc.ru/hr/137121-4-vyzova-agile-transformacii-dlya-liderov-biznesaАлферов П.А., Крюнькин Е.Н. Малахов А.А, Ожаровский А.В., Потеев П.М. Преимущества Agile // Сумма технологии – центр подготовки руководители и команд цифровой трансформации – [Москва], 2022. – URL:https://gosagile.cdto.ranepa.ru/1_2Каковы преимущества использования методологии Agile? // AppMaster– 2022. –URL:https://appmaster.io/ru/blog/kakovy-preimushchestva-ispol-zovaniia-metodologii-agile

1.Лобасев Д. В. Фреймворк Agile-трансформации крупных организаций // Актуальные исследования. – 2022. – С. 26-33. URL: https://apni.ru/article/5011-frejmvork-agile-transformatsii-krupnikh-organ
2.Машков А. Что такое Agile // Week.ru – [Москва], 2022. – URL: https://weeek.net/ru/blog/chto-takoe-agile
3.«Газпром нефть» рассказала о внедрении Agile на самой крупной конференции по гибким методологиям // Специализированный журнал «Бурение&Нефть» – 2018. – URL: https://burneft.ru/main/news/20762
4.5-летие Sbergile: итоги самой большой Agile-трансформации в мире // ПАО Сбербанк – [Москва], 2021. – URL: https://www.sberbank.com/ru/news-and-media/press-releases/article?newsID=27df3305-bbb2-41d1-ab6d-34e85d12abd7&blockID=7®ionID=77&lang=ru&type=NEWS,%202021.
5.4 вызова Agile трансформации для лидеров бизнеса // vc.ru - Крупнейшая в России и СНГ площадка для предпринимателей нового поколения – 2020. – URL: https://vc.ru/hr/137121-4-vyzova-agile-transformacii-dlya-liderov-biznesa
6.Алферов П.А., Крюнькин Е.Н. Малахов А.А, Ожаровский А.В., Потеев П.М. Преимущества Agile // Сумма технологии – центр подготовки руководители и команд цифровой трансформации – [Москва], 2022. – URL: https://gosagile.cdto.ranepa.ru/1_2
7.Каковы преимущества использования методологии Agile? // AppMaster – 2022. – URL: https://appmaster.io/ru/blog/kakovy-preimushchestva-ispol-zovaniia-metodologii-agile